The Little Tina’s Wonderland server status is unfortunately messy. Tini Tina’s March 25 release date was followed by a lot of issues and server issues with a typical gearbox.

At 10:08 p.m. ET on March 26, SHiFT Status, the company responsible for maintaining the Gearboxes servers, took to Twitter to acknowledge public outrage at the online connectivity issues plaguing Tiny Tina Wonderland. “The team is currently working on connectivity issues with SHiFT cross-references causing players to disconnect,” ShiFT said.

The comments for this announcement were again a typical mix of gear boxing with a mixture of disappointment, apathy and fan support. Server issues plagued players on Saturday, with persistent Twitter posts reassuring fans that the issues would be resolved, and more outraged fans that they were disappointed not to be playing with their friends. Clarification of the issues began around 5 p.m. ET, similar to the last update, with some of the Twitter comments confirming that they were finally able to go live.
